Welcome to the Splash Zone, the quickest way to get your day started off right. We bring you a rundown of Miami Dolphins news from the last 24 hours.

The Dolphins made several moves yesterday, all releases, by saying goodbye to Mario Williams, and Earl Mitchell. The Dolphins freed up some cap space by releasing these three. Jordan Phillips may be bumped up to starter now and Andre Branch took over for Williams, but Branch is set to be a free agent. The Dolphins defense is expected to undergo some major changes and with this cap relief, the team is putting themselves in a good position.
